Aperçu du produit
SV88-KIT vibration and temperature monitoring kit helps users monitor critical equipment by continuously analysing vibrations from rotating equipment, detecting faults, and alerting users to potential defects and future problems. With its multi-communication protocols, rugged, IP66 rating and wireless capability, the SV88 vibration monitoring solution kit allows users to make critical data-driven decisions that alert potential issues to aid in extending the life of your valuable assets. Wireless capability enhances installation flexibility, enabling easy deployment in a range of industrial environments. The SV88 seamlessly integrates with advanced analysis tools through multi-communication protocols such as Modbus, MQTT, and OPC UA. Web based GUI for accessing vibration data, deploying sensors, and managing integrations, all performed on Gateway, ensuring you have complete control over your vibration solution.
- TA87 universal power adaptor: 100V to 240VAC, 50/60Hz (optional) AC input
- Configurable: 1 min (minimum) - 1 day (maximum) capture rate
- Range up to 50m (line of sight), sensitivity range up to ±16g
- Display measurement trend of contact temperature -20°C to 80°C (-4°F to 176°F)
- Sensor: TCP Socket; Gateway: MQTT, Modbus, OPC UA communication protocol
- IP rating is sensor: IP66, gateway: IP40
- 3 years warranty, -20°C to 80°C operating temperature range
- ETL/FCC/IC/CE/UKCA/RCM certified
- 5 KHz, X/Y/Z: 19,200 raw data (output data)
- Size is sensor: 29 × 25 × 14mm/gateway: 57.3 × 39.3 × 46.1mm
